Head Specifications

tank head dimensions diagramWhat are the dimensional and stylistic attributes required for the tank head? Most of the following specifications are required to quote and build your tank head:

  • Head Style
  • Quantity
  • Diameter
  • Dish Radius
  • Inside Knuckle Radius
  • Straight Flange
  • Material Type
  • Nominal Thickness or Minimum Thickness
  • Edge Machining
  • Radiography Requirements
  • ASME Code Required
  • Inside Material Finish
  • Outside Material Finish

Special Requirements

Are there any special requirements your project or company needs to meet? Special requirements you should mention to your manufacturer could include any of the following:

  • Critical Dimensions
  • Value-added components: Manways, gaskets, safety relief valves, heat transfer, etc.
  • Special testing such as PMI or impact testing.
  • Special documentation such as Certificates of Conformance, RA maps, thickness maps, x-ray reader sheets, etc.
